An inlet pipe can fill an empty tank in 30 minutes
whereas an outlet pipe can empty the fully filled tank in 45 minutes. Find the time taken by both the pipes together to fill half of the empty tank.Solution
Let the total capacity of tank be 90 litres (LCM of 30 and 45)
Efficiency of inlet pipe = (90/30) = 3 litres/minute
Efficiency of outlet pipe = (90/45) = -2 litres/minute
Required time = (0.5 × 90) ÷ (3 - 2) = 45 minutes
